Handover: encoding detection, Patchwell uploads

Current state: detector handles UTF-8/16 fine; Shift-JIS heuristic is flaky on small files under 2KB. Fallback is Latin-1, logged with a warning. Don't trust the confidence score below 0.6 — treat as unknown. Tests live in the textsniff suite. Open issues and the detection flowchart are on the team page below.

wiki page, tahaf-tajog: https://jira.ordindyn.corp/pipeline

Team — effective this sprint, ownership of the Lanternview map-tile prefetcher moves off the Roadscout platform squad. Prefetch cache tuning, the eviction heuristics, and the Kestrelport CDN warmup jobs all transfer with it. Open bugs reassigned; no change to the release cadence. Questions about the prefetcher or its dashboards go to one person going forward. Direct all escalations to the new owner listed below.

approver of tagef-hawef = Oliok Julath

## Known Issue: Query Planner Regression

After the Pellworth 4.2 upgrade, the planner occasionally chooses a full scan on the bookings table when the partition filter includes a subquery. Symptoms: query latency above 30s and elevated disk reads on replica nodes. Apply the documented planner hint as a stopgap and record the query fingerprint in the incident channel. For persistent cases, contact the storage team.

escalation mailbox, bafog-fafog: ulador@paliqlabs.internal

- [ ] Show the new starter the Willowbeck recording studio on level 2 — it's where we film all the Quillfort training videos. Make sure they know to check the booking sheet before barging in, as lights on means filming. The studio door stays locked outside sessions, so they'll need the pass code below.

badge for fafop-fajof: bdg-Z-47